SpletSwarm Electrification (SE) is a relatively new concept, gaining considerable attention as a tool to provide last-mile electrification. A swarm grid is like a micro-grid, but rather than a planned network, it is assembled in an ad-hoc manner, connecting available equipment and growing organically as more resources become available mitigating the capital … SpletDownloadable! The rural electrification of Sub-Saharan Africa and South-East Asia is crucial to end the energy poverty in which around 1 billion people are trapped. Swarm electrification, i.e., the progressive building of decentralized and decarbonized electric infrastructure in a bottom-up manner, tackles rural electrification challenges by quickly … gas prices in mount laurel nj
